Recently the singer-songwriter Jewel came to my son’s school to present her new book. She charmed the students with her singing, so I decided to take a look at That’s What I’d Do. Few books capture the deep love a mother has for her child as well as this picture book/CD set.

The rhyming couplets tell of the limitless dedication of a mother: her willingness to do whatever she can to make her child’s life safe and nurturing; her joy in sacrifice; her contentment in seeing her child explore his world. Amy June Bates’ illustrations are warm and comfortable, capturing the special moments mother and baby spend together throughout the day. The accompanying recording of Jewel singing the text is simply enchanting. Mothers and children will enjoy sharing this little treasure for many years.
